TP安卓版转账失败全解析:便捷资产转移、合约监控与策略优化

很多用户在 TP(安卓版)进行转账时会遇到“转账失败”的提示。通常这不是单一原因,而是从网络、地址、合约、签名、额度到市场环境等多个环节同时叠加导致。下面我用“全方位排查 + 策略优化”的方式,把常见问题按模块拆开讲清楚,覆盖:便捷资产转移、合约监控、行业态势、高效能市场策略、公钥、支付限额。你可以按顺序逐条核对,基本能把问题定位到原因层级。

一、先明确:转账失败到底失败在哪一步

1)失败提示的类型

- “地址/参数错误”:多半是收款地址格式、链选择、代币合约不匹配、金额精度等。

- “余额不足/手续费不足”:通常是账户余额不足,或 gas/手续费留得不够。

- “签名失败/授权失败”:可能是权限、合约调用失败、签名过期或钱包状态异常。

- “网络超时/广播失败”:多与网络拥堵、节点质量、RPC不稳定有关。

- “合约执行失败”:往往是合约状态、额度规则、路由/路径配置或交易参数不合法。

2)先做最小复现

同一条链上、同一个代币、同一个收款地址、同一个金额,多次尝试会很快暴露规律:

- 如果金额变化就能成功,问题可能是精度或最低金额/手续费。

- 如果更换收款地址能成功,问题多在地址或校验。

- 如果换网络(例如切换Wi-Fi/4G)就能成功,问题通常是网络与节点。

二、便捷资产转移:让“转得动”优先于“转得快”

便捷资产转移的核心是:减少人为错误与链路不确定性。

1)链与代币要完全匹配

- TP里要确保选对链(主网/测试网、同一生态的不同链常常相互不兼容)。

- 代币要确认是正确的合约地址或正确的代币标识。很多“失败”来自“看似同名但合约不同”。

2)金额与小数精度校验

- 不同代币精度不同(例如有的支持 6 位小数,有的支持 18 位)。

- 如果输入了不符合精度的金额,可能在签名前就被拦截或在合约执行时失败。

3)手续费/网络费要预留

- 部分钱包会显示“可转余额”,但未必把手续费计入。

- 对于需要合约调用的转账(比如代币转账走合约,或包含兑换/路由),gas会更高。

4)回执与交易状态

- 有时“失败”其实是“广播后未被确认”,钱包端会提示失败或超时。

- 建议你在链上浏览器查询交易哈希:

- 若已上链但钱包提示失败,可能是状态回显延迟。

- 若没上链,可能是节点广播质量或手续费过低。

三、合约监控:把“合约执行失败”从黑盒变成可读信息

当你转的并非原生币、而是 ERC20/同类代币,或涉及 DEX/路由/授权合约时,“合约监控”尤为关键。

1)常见合约失败原因

- 余额/授权不足:代币转账前若需要授权,授权额度不够会失败。

- 交易参数不合法:例如路由地址、路径、最小输出 amount(slippage)不满足。

- 合约处于限制状态:如交易窗口、黑名单、冻结账户等。

- gas 不足:合约需要更多执行资源。

2)如何做合约监控与验证

- 在链上用浏览器查看交易失败原因(如果钱包/链支持 revert reason 更清晰)。

- 对代币合约:核对“函数调用”是否符合预期(transfer / transferFrom 等)。

- 对授权:确认授权额度(allowance)是否足够,以及是否授权到正确的合约地址。

3)最实用的排查法:对比成功交易

- 如果你以前同类操作能成功,优先对比成功时的:手续费设置、金额精度、是否需要授权、是否走了路由。

- 找到差异后通常能“一步定位”。

四、行业态势:为什么同样操作会在不同时间失败

行业态势包括链上拥堵、手续费市场波动、监管或风控策略、以及交易流量突增等。

1)链上拥堵与手续费波动

- 在高峰期,节点队列堆积,gas被迫提高。

- 如果你的 TP 手续费设置偏低,可能出现“超时/未能广播/未确认”。

2)节点与网络波动

- 钱包依赖 RPC/节点服务;节点质量差时会出现间歇性失败。

- 建议:切换网络环境(Wi-Fi/4G),必要时更换钱包内的节点/服务(若提供)。

3)风控与合规规则变化

- 某些链或桥接/交易路由会引入额外限制。

- 如果你使用的是跨链/桥接/兑换聚合,失败可能来自路由方的动态策略。

五、高效能市场策略:把“转账”和“执行时机”结合起来

如果你遇到的“转账失败”发生在特定场景(如先转再交易、转账后立刻兑换),那么策略能显著降低失败率与滑点。

1)分步执行降低失败耦合

- 先小额测试转账是否成功。

- 再执行大额,避免一次就触发合约/额度/精度等连锁问题。

2)降低拥堵时段执行风险

- 选择链上较空的时间段(通常是低拥堵时)发起交易。

- 或提高手续费/优先级,让交易更快被打包。

3)滑点与最小成交量(若涉及兑换)

- 若转账失败伴随兑换/路由,常见是“最小输出”不满足。

- 提高允许滑点或调整路径参数,让执行更有概率成功。

4)监控与回滚预案

- 若你正在做连续操作(转账→兑换→再转账),建议:每一步确认成功后再进入下一步。

- 失败时保留交易哈希以便后续追踪,避免反复重发造成重复交易。

六、公钥:地址背后的“身份标识”,避免因混淆导致的失败

“公钥”与“地址”紧密相关。虽然大多数钱包让你直接输入地址,但理解公钥能帮助你避免一些隐性错误。

1)公钥与地址的关系

- 钱包实际使用公钥生成地址;你看到的地址相当于公钥的派生结果。

- 若你导入了不同的助记词/私钥对应的钱包,地址会改变,可能导致余额不在你以为的账号上。

2)常见误区

- 用了错误的钱包身份:同一台手机上可能有多个账户/助记词。

- 收款方地址是“来自另一条链/另一种格式”的地址:看起来像地址但实际派生规则不同。

- 你以为转给了朋友,却是复制错了字符(公钥派生地址非常依赖精确字符)。

3)建议做法

- 收款前先粘贴校验:核对前后几位、长度与链前缀。

- 用“二维码/联系人”减少手动输入错误。

- 确认当前账户地址与余额所在地址一致。

七、支付限额:失败的“硬门槛”要提前测

支付限额可能来自三类:钱包/账户层面的限额、链上协议/合约规则的限额、以及交易路由/平台的风控额度。

1)钱包或平台的转账限额

- 有些钱包对单笔、单日、累计额度有限制。

- 可能会在达到阈值后出现失败而不是明确提示原因。

2)合约层面的额度规则

- 授权额度(allowance)就是一种“支付限额”。当 allowance 小于本次转账所需金额,会失败。

- 有的代币合约带有最大转账量、冷却时间或交易限制。

3)链上余额与最小手续费

- 即使你有余额,若手续费不足也会被视为“无法支付”,从而失败。

4)如何处理

- 检查钱包是否展示“单笔/日限额”。如有,分多次转或等额度重置。

- 如涉及授权:在链上确认 allowance,并在必要时提升授权额度(注意授权合约地址必须正确)。

- 对最小手续费:提高手续费设置,或在低拥堵时发起。

八、给你一套快速排查清单(按概率从高到低)

1)确认链/代币/收款地址是否完全匹配。

2)核对金额精度,尽量先用最小测试金额。

3)检查余额是否覆盖“代币金额 + 手续费/gas”。

4)若是代币转账或涉及兑换:检查授权(allowance)是否足够。

5)查看交易哈希(若能拿到):判断是否已上链但钱包超时。

6)切换网络环境或更换钱包节点/RPC(如可设置)。

7)若仍失败:结合链上合约执行信息(revert reason)进行定向修复。

九、结语:把失败变成“可定位问题”

TP安卓版转账失败并不一定是你操作错了,也可能是节点拥堵、合约规则变化、额度限制或签名参数异常。只要你按本文的模块化思路:从便捷资产转移(链/地址/精度/手续费)开始,再做合约监控(授权与参数),最后结合行业态势(拥堵/节点)与支付限额(钱包/合约规则),基本就能把原因锁定到明确方向,然后再用高效能市场策略做时机与流程优化,让下一次成功率显著提升。

作者:霁岚科技编辑部发布时间:2026-04-24 18:05:02

评论

LunaCatcher

按你说的先小额测试,发现原来是手续费没留够,换了设置后立刻成功了。

晨雾回声

“公钥/地址混淆”这一段很有用,之前总以为复制地址不会错,结果还是看错了链前缀。

ByteHarbor

合约监控讲得清楚,尤其是授权额度 allowanace 不够导致转账失败的情况。

凌波微步

行业态势导致的拥堵我以前没想到,选低峰发起后失败率确实下降。

SaffronFox

高效能市场策略那段“分步确认再下一步”太实用了,避免了连续操作一起翻车。

SkyRail

支付限额和最小手续费一起排查,感觉比盲目重试更有效,赞。

相关阅读
<strong lang="nxjn"></strong><strong dir="8iz5"></strong><tt dir="j3vx"></tt><var id="0flk"></var>